A new report from RiskIQ helps to establish the rapid growth of cybersecurity threats online. This report, referenced at the Evil Internet Minute 2020, offers a breakdown of both the number and type of threats that are emerging, estimating that roughly 375 new cybersecurity threats are occurring every sixty seconds.
The report also notes that COVID-19 seems to be a significant factor in these threats, as hackers look to use interest in the virus to drive people to malicious sites, or to gain access to accounts via phishing activities. In particular, 14.6 COVID-related hosts are created every minute.
On the defensive side, the report also notes some successes in protecting against emerging threats, with a COVID-19 related phishing domain being blacklisted an average of once every 15 minutes, and a mobile app being blacklisted every three minutes.
